#8141bc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8141bc is composed of 50.6% red, 25.5%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.4% cyan, 65.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 271.2 degrees, a saturation of 48.6% and a lightness of 49.6%. #8141bc color hex could be obtained by blending #ff82ff with #030079.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

#8141bc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8141bc has RGB values of R:129, G:65,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:0.65,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 8470972.

Shades and Tints of #8141bc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09050d is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#8141bc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f7b82 is the less saturated color, while #8307f6 is the most saturated one.
